Question 1131486: the length of the longer leg of a right triangle is 14 feet longer than the length of the shorter leg x. the hypotenuse is 6 feet longer than twice the length of the shorter leg. find the dimensions of the triangle.

short leg         x
long leg          x+14
hypotenuse        2x+6


simplify and solve.
